John Graves wrote:
 Mark,
 
 Are those lenses birds of a feather, so to speak?  Or you are willing to 
 try any of the flavors?

Yes. All the same lens, manufactured by Cosina and sold under various 
brand names (Cosina, Vivitar, Promaster, Samyang, Phoenix are a few of 
them - there may be more). Up until the Tokina-built DA* lenses, it was 
one of only two lenses that Pentax had made by an outside manufacturer 
(the other being the FA 28-200 f/3.8-5.6 made by Tamron).

I'd prefer the Vivitar, but any brand name will do if it's that lens. (I 
have some experiments in mind...)
